i invented unix part of fidoip, and done this basically from zero. After
one year ago when i tired of vista bugs and wiped out windows from my hdd
and migrated to linux. Then i faced the challenge with complexity of fido
software installation for this OS. So fistly i wrote slackbuild for
slackware which automate installation, then i tried other disros ans so on,
wrote script to automate installation on them, and so on...

for basis of windows part of fidoip i used software package of by fido-boss
Kirill Temnenkov, 2:5020/828, and i suppose he created this package for his
points to simplify their life. This package(FTN.rar) is avalaible at
http://temnenkov.narod.ru/fido/

i just modified this package - changed names of directories of
fido-bases(for matching unix ones) to simplify migration from windows to
unix and from unix to windows. Also this allowed to use USB-flash memory as
storage of fido-bases and to use this flash on different PC and different
OSs. Other modification i done - modified
vbs-configurator(setup_config.vbs) so that could set up configuration not
only for points of node 2:5020/828 but for whole world.
